Summer Program 2013 Cost Summary
Three Week Academic and Cultural Program
Cost per person $2,900
(US Dollars)

  • Three-week instruction for academic classes (morning lectures and afternoon hands-on workshops)
  • Classroom materials (this includes all the materials and presentations used by the instructor)
  • Student fees for local tours and museums (visits to Native American Akwesasne reservation, Remington Museum, Adirondack Museum, Wild Center, Sunfeather Soap, and a visit to the Thousand Islands)
  • Health Insurance for duration of stay (this is mandatory for all students staying on campus)
  • Three weeks on campus housing (linens, towels, blankets included)
  • Two nights’ accommodations at University of Buffalo for visit to Niagara Falls, NY (linens, towels included)
  • Three nights’ accommodations in New York City during visit to New York City
  • Trip to Adirondack Mountains and Lake Placid (transportation and visit to the Wild Center, Adirondack Museum fees included)
  • All meals (three meals a day included), except when traveling on weekends
  • Transportation from JFK airport to SUNY Canton
  • Transportation to and from Niagara Falls, NY
  • Transportation from SUNY Canton to New York, NY
  • Transportation for local tours

Visa Interview Fee: Will differ per country
